Runoff for Attala sheriff

KOSCIUSKO, Miss. (AP) — Interim Attala County Sheriff Tim Nail and Martin Roby will be in a Nov. 27 runoff for sheriff.

The Star Herald reports that Billy J. "Joey" Halderman ran third in Tuesday's special election.

The special election is to fill the unexpired term of William Lee, who died in May. Lee had been sheriff since 2002.

Roby ran for the office in 2007 and lost to Lee in a runoff.

Nail has served as interim sheriff since Lee's death on May 7.
